我需要哪个版本的Visual Studio才能使用MySQL?

14

我正在Windows上安装MySQL,并在检查要求部分询问Visual Studio。我以前没有安装Visual Studio,因此我下载并安装了Visual Studio Community。然后,我点击了MySQL的检查按钮,以查看是否已安装Visual Studio,但它并未识别出来。(我还尝试关闭MySQL安装程序并重新打开它,以及重新启动计算机)

我需要特定版本的Visual Studio吗?

谢谢, André。


5
Visual Studio 和 MySQL 有什么关系? - David
4
我不知道 @David,从未使用过MySQL,但我确定它会在检查要求部分询问。我想发布一张截图,但我很悲惨,甚至没有足够的徽章来做到这一点 :( - André Gomes
嗨,@David,你可以看到Visual Studio可以用于MySQL http://www.mysql.com/why-mysql/windows/visualstudio/ - André Gomes
5个回答

34

使用MySQL并不需要安装Visual Studio。

但是,如果你想使用“MySQL for Visual Studio”,就需要安装VS 2008、2010、2012、2013、2015版本或更新版本(根据安装程序而定)。

在使用Windows MSI安装程序安装时,在“安装类型”中,您可能会选择“开发人员默认设置”,其中包括“MySQL for Visual Studio”,这将需要安装Visual Studio。如果你不需要VS,选择一个不安装“MySQL for Visual Studio”的安装类型。


5
安装时,请选择“自定义”设置类型,然后保留所有内容,仅通过单击左箭头将“MySql for Visual Studio”移至左侧以进行删除。就是这样! - Eray T

3
如果您在Windows上安装MySQL,则需要在系统上安装Visual Studio。回答这个问题的时候,支持的版本是Visual Studio 2012、2013、2015或2017。
如果MySQL设置无法识别您的Visual Studio,请安装Visual Studio的.NET开发人员工具。这样就可以解决问题了。对我来说也是如此。

这个答案已经过时了,也没有提供任何来源。 - Clément
答案并不过时... 当前的安装在许多系统上出现故障,需要使用Visual Studio的.NET开发工具作为一种解决方法,但并非所有情况都适用... https://bugs.mysql.com/bug.php?id=85908 - Ricky

0

安装程序的官方文档如下:

安装要求

MySQL Installer需要Microsoft .NET Framework 4.5.2或更高版本。如果主机计算机上没有安装此版本,则可以通过访问Microsoft网站来下载它。

所以,与Visual Studio无关。

但是,在尝试安装MySQL Shell时,您可能会收到以下错误消息:

MySQL Shell 8.0.19 2…
此应用程序需要Visual Studio 2019 Redistributable。请安装Redistributable,然后再次运行此安装程序。

您可能会看到“MySQL for Visual Studio 1.2.9 2”的相同要求。


0

-1

MySQL for Visual Studio 只能直接集成到 Visual Studio 2008、2010 和 2012 中。


2
此回答已过时,且未提供来源。 - Clément

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接